Govt focused on development, augmentation of basic facilities: Minister

Decrease Font Size Increase Font Size Text Size Print This Page

Reasi: Minister of State for Finance and Planning, Ajay Nanda today asserted that the state government has laid special focus on development and augmentation of basic amenities to ensure improve living standard of common man. 

The Minister was speaking at a pubic grievance redress camp after dedicating   power sub-station to the people  of village Laiter Danga developed at a cost of Rs  Rs 3.35 lakh and provided by him out of  CDF. 

Ajay Nanda said that the Government is focusing on expansion of road connectivity, augmentation of drinking water and power infra and improvement of  education standards in rural areas.

He reviewed the pace of   developmental works taken up under convergence of MGNREGA and   other schemes and took stock of the grievances of the people.

The Minister directed the concerned officers to redress problems of the people on priority. He asked the field functionaries to create awareness among public about the schemes of their departments to enable people of far flung areas to take benefit. 

  Responding to various issues raised by locals, the Minister assured them of early redressal of all genuine demands.

  BDO Harpal Singh, Tehsildar Rajesh Baru, engineers and officers of various departments, former sarpanches and panches besides a large number of people were present on the occasion.
